Mikroprogramlar nedir? Tanım, Örnekler ve Kullanımlar
Mikro program, belirli bir görevi veya görevler dizisini gerçekleştirmek için kullanılan küçük bir programdır. Tipik olarak normal bir programdan daha küçüktür ve daha uzmanlaşmıştır ve genellikle gömülü sistemlerde veya alanın ve kaynakların sınırlı olduğu diğer uygulamalarda kullanılır. performans ve verimlilik için optimize edilmiştir. ROM'da (salt okunur bellek) veya başka kalıcı bellekte saklanabilirler ve bir mikroişlemci veya başka bir küçük bilgisayar sistemi tarafından yürütülürler.
Mikroprogramların bazı yaygın örnekleri şunlardır:
1. Firmware: Bu, yazıcı veya yönlendirici gibi bir cihazın çalışmasını kontrol etmek için kullanılan bir tür mikro programdır. Aygıt yazılımı tipik olarak ROM'da saklanır ve bir mikroişlemci veya başka bir küçük bilgisayar sistemi tarafından yürütülür.
2. Gömülü sistemler: Bunlar, cihazlar, araçlar veya endüstriyel ekipmanlar gibi diğer cihazlara gömülü olan küçük bilgisayar sistemleridir. Gömülü sistemler genellikle belirli görevleri veya işlevleri gerçekleştirmek için mikroprogramları kullanır.
3. Mikrodenetleyiciler: Diğer cihaz veya sistemleri kontrol etmek için kullanılan küçük bilgisayar sistemleridir. Mikrodenetleyiciler genellikle belirli görevleri veya işlevleri gerçekleştirmek için mikroprogramları kullanır.
4. Özel yazılım: Bu, görüntü işleme veya bilimsel simülasyonlar gibi belirli bir görevi veya görev dizisini gerçekleştirmek için tasarlanmış yazılımı içerebilir. Özel yazılımlar, performansı ve verimliliği optimize etmek için mikroprogramlar kullanabilir.
Genel olarak, mikroprogramlar, gömülü sistemlerde, ürün yazılımında, mikro denetleyicilerde ve alan ve kaynakların sınırlı olduğu diğer uygulamalarda belirli görevleri veya işlevleri gerçekleştirmek için kullanılan küçük, özel programlardır. Genellikle performans ve verimlilik açısından yüksek düzeyde optimize edilirler ve ROM'da veya diğer kalıcı bellekte saklanırlar.